ESCC Details

Evans & Sutherland Computer Corporation engages in the design, manufacture, marketing, and support of visual systems for planetariums, digital theaters, science centers, educational institutions, and entertainment venues worldwide. The company offers image generators, domes, and display systems, as well as projection, sound, lighting, computer control systems, and domed projection screens. It also provides dome projection screens and dome architectural treatments to theme parks, casinos, world expositions, museums, schools, and military defense contractors. The company was founded in 1968 and is based in Salt Lake City, Utah.

Evans & Sutherland Gets Letter From NASDAQ

On June 26, 2009, Evans & Sutherland Computer Corporation (E&S) received a letter from The NASDAQ Stock Market (NASDAQ) indicating that E&S does not comply with Listing Rule 5550(b), which requires E&S to have a minimum of $2,500,000 in stockholders’ equity or $35,000,000 market value of listed securities or $500,000 of net income from continuing operations for the most recently completed fiscal year or two of the three most recently completed fiscal years. The letter also indicated that E&S had not regained compliance during the extension period granted by NASDAQ in April 2009. The letter further provides that, unless E&S requests an appeal of NASDAQ’s determination, trading of E&S’ common stock will be suspended on July 8, 2009. E&S has determined not to request an appeal of NASDAQ’s determination. E&S has been advised by Pink OTC Markets Inc. that its securities are immediately eligible for quotation at the open of business on July 8, 2009. E&S common shares may, in the future, also be quoted on the Over-the-Counter Bulletin Board, provided that a market maker in the E&S common stock files the appropriate application with, and such application is cleared by, FINRA.

Evans & Sutherland to Debut New 8K x 4K Pixel Laser Projector at InfoComm09

Evans & Sutherland Computer Corp. announced it will demonstrate its revolutionary new laser projection system at the InfoComm09 tradeshow, booth 2372, June 17-19 in Orlando, Florida. This newest E&S Laser Projector is the world's highest resolution production video projector, and will offer research labs, control rooms, creative studios and indoor venues worldwide a window into worlds both real and imaginary, with fidelity that exceeds the limits of the human eye. Laser projectors with NanoPixel(TM) technology are already in use in a growing number of planetarium theaters around the world, as part of the successful E&S Digistar(TM) Laser fulldome planetarium system. With the ESLP 8K, available in the second half of 2009, E&S is delivering this technology to the general projection marketplace with newly available flat-screen and panoramic-screen form factors. The new projector is also capable of displaying 3D in the highest resolution from any single projector: 4K x 4K. NanoPixel Technology Generates Superior Picture Quality: The ESLP 8K laser projector system displays content the equivalent to 16 times HD 1080p resolution, or the difference between 2 million pixels and 32 million. It is powered by a set of revolutionary laser light sources which offer multiple benefits, including low cost of operation. The hue of the lasers does not degrade or shift over time. Furthermore, the lasers yield a much wider useable color spectrum (200% of NTSC/HDTV) than is available in conventional LCoS, DLP, LCD, or other lamp-illuminated projectors.
